lin50
Pier to Pier HM done - mainly 30:30 with extra walks up the hill at mile 4, 9 and 13 and extra run throughs downhill.
Pleased with an official finish time of 2:32:41.
It’s a nice low key event (302 finishers) by RunWales. Medal & T-shirt at the finish, and a nice surprise- I’d forgotten that I’d ordered a hoodie too!

About This Thread

Maintained by RevBarbaraG
A thread about the merits (or otherwise) and practice of including walk breaks in runs - particularly, though not exclusively, as recommended by Jeff Galloway.
